East-West Negotiations Print E-mail
This course is intended to introduce students to the practical legal and cultural issues encountered when negotiating international agreements in an Asian context. Particular emphasis will be placed on negotiations involving Japanese and non-Japanese parties through the examination of actual international commercial transactions. The course will work through a conceptual framework to better identify and understand the principles and processes behind successful negotiation. It will serve to raise students' ability to Negotiate effectively in a cross-cultural environment.
